Associations between exposure to viruses and bovine respiratory disease in Australian feedlot cattle
文摘

Seroepidemiology of BVDV-1, BoHV-1, BRSV and BPIV-3 and risk of BRD was investigated.

For each virus, being seronegative at entry increased risk of BRD in feedlot cattle.

Animals seronegative for more than one virus were at progressively increased risk.

For each virus seroincrease resulted in increased risk of BRD in feedlot cattle.

Seroincrease for more than one virus further increased risk of BRD.
